E-COM-NET
首页
在线工具
Layui镜像站
SUI文档
联系我们
推荐频道
Java
PHP
C++
C
C#
Python
Ruby
go语言
Scala
Servlet
Vue
MySQL
NoSQL
Redis
CSS
Oracle
SQL Server
DB2
HBase
Http
HTML5
Spring
Ajax
Jquery
JavaScript
Json
XML
NodeJs
mybatis
Hibernate
算法
设计模式
shell
数据结构
大数据
JS
消息中间件
正则表达式
Tomcat
SQL
Nginx
Shiro
Maven
Linux
java字符串常量池
有关String的相关方法 和
常量池
API基础第一天:笔记:String:字符串类型java.lang.String使用的final修饰,不能被继承字符串底层封装了字符数组以及针对字符数组的操作算法
Java字符串
在内存中采用Unicode
芳的忠实粉丝
·
2022-09-22 16:29
java
开发语言
String与字符串
常量池
——(字符串底层存储)
String与字符串
常量池
主要考察的是我们对于字符串底层存储的理解
常量池
:我们都知道作为字符串一旦创建以后就是final修饰的,也就是不可变。
发呆小菜鸟
·
2022-09-22 16:59
Java面试
java
面试
string
字符串常量池
【JavaSE】String类与字符串
常量池
文章目录1.String类的特性2.String的不可变性3.字符串
常量池
4.String的两种赋值方式5.String不同的拼接操作1.String类的特性String:字符串,使用一对“”引起来表示
り澄忆秋、
·
2022-09-22 16:23
JavaSE
java
day2 java基础连环10问,你能坚持到第几问?【面试篇】
包装类型的
常量池
技术了解么?自动装箱与拆箱了解吗?原理是什么?面向对象和面向过程的区别成员变量与局部变量的区别创建一个对象用什么运算符?对象实体与对象引用有何不同?
学无止境java
·
2022-09-22 16:49
java基础复习
java
mysql
idea
eclipse
【Java】String类的理解及字符串
常量池
文章目录一.String类简介1.介绍2.字符串构造二.字符串
常量池
(StringTable)1.思考?
XIN-XIANG荣
·
2022-09-22 16:10
Java
SE
java
jvm
开发语言
后端
String
40道Java基础常见面试题及详细答案
八种基本数据类型的大小,以及他们的封装类引用数据类型Switch能否用string做参数equals与==的区别自动装箱,
常量池
Object有哪些公用方法Java的四种引用,强弱软虚,用到的场景Hashcode
C陈三岁
·
2022-09-15 13:53
java
面试
开发语言
java
算法
Java面试题及答案,2022年最新版,针对高频面试点
基础1、JVM原理①、Java内存区域的分配JVM虚拟机内存模型实现规范:按线程是否共享分为以下区域:所有线程共享的数据区:方法区(JVM规范中的一部分,不是实际的实现):存储每一个类的结构信息(运行时
常量池
Java程序员-张凯
·
2022-09-14 22:30
java
面试
jvm
Java面试题
java面试题及答案
牛客Java专项练习
survivor区
常量池
eden区old区参考文章:Java内存区域和GC机制程序计数器PCRegister每个线程都有一个程序计算器,就是一个指针,指向方法区中的方法字
•••
·
2022-09-12 11:23
Java基础面试题
java
51.【Java String方法的小结】
Java字符串
String大全1.String1.1创建String对象的两种方式:2.内存图3.字符串的比较:3.1使用非函数3.2运用函数进行比较3.3运用函数判断相等与否的实列2.字符串的索引1.
吉士先生.
·
2022-09-12 10:40
java
jvm
开发语言
金九银十,收下这份 Java String 面试题
在这篇文章里,我将总结
Java字符串
中重要的知识点&面试题,如果能帮上忙,请务必点赞加关注,这真的对我非常重要。
一头狒狒
·
2022-09-08 04:17
java
java
jvm
servlet
面试
开发语言
Java运算符
Java运算符Java运算符概述Java算术运算符Java关系运算符Java逻辑运算符Java位运算符Java赋值运算符Java条件运算符
Java字符串
连接运算符Java运算符概述掌握常见的Java运算符的使用
·
2022-09-06 07:43
#+
Java
java
jvm
数据结构
字符串
常量池
,看这篇就够了(三)
手撸过JVM、内存池、垃圾回收算法、synchronized、线程池、NIO、三色标记算法…这篇文章是专栏字符串
常量池
的第三篇。如果前两篇你还没看,墙裂都建议你回去看一下,
子牙老师
·
2022-09-06 06:47
java
jvm
字符串
常量池
,看这篇就够了(二)
手撸过JVM、内存池、垃圾回收算法、synchronized、线程池、NIO、三色标记算法…这篇文章是谈字符串
常量池
的第二篇。如果上一篇你还没看,建议先回去看一下,再来看本
子牙老师
·
2022-09-06 06:47
java
jvm
字符串
常量池
,看这篇就够了(一)
字符串
常量池
,即Java代码中的字符串在JVM中到底是如何
子牙老师
·
2022-09-06 06:16
jvm
美团暑期实习面经
3.JVM的内存模型4.
常量池
放在哪里5.new了两个String对象,直接创建了两个String对象,问它们俩之间分别相等吗有点记不太清楚,回
dragonzlcsu
·
2022-09-05 17:45
面经
java
面试
第五节 字符串底层实现
一、
常量池
1、
常量池
分类(1)class文件中的
常量池
:存在于硬盘上,使用命令“javap-verbose”可以查看;(2)运行时
常量池
:InstanceKlass的一个属性,ConstantPool*
十八度的天空
·
2022-09-03 14:07
JVM
jvm
JavaSE——字符串
常量池
(StringTable)
流川枫的博客专栏:和我一起学java语录:Stayhungrystayfoolish工欲善其事必先利其器,给大家介绍一款超牛的斩获大厂offer利器——牛客网点击免费注册和我一起刷题吧文章目录1.字符串
常量池
敲代码の流川枫
·
2022-09-03 14:50
和我一起学java
jvm
java
开发语言
面经-虚拟机-类加载
③解析-将
常量池
的符号引用解析为直接引用。3.初始化①执行静态代码块与非final静态变量赋值。②初始化是懒惰执行。双亲委派双亲委派:优先委派上级类加载器进行加
临易i
·
2022-08-29 07:15
java
jvm
开发语言
面经-Java创建对象的过程
java创建对象的过程主要分为一下五个步骤:(1)类加载检查Java虚拟机(jvm)在读取一条new指令时候,首先检查能否在
常量池
中定位到这个类的符号引用,并且检查这个符号引用代表的类是否被加载、解析和初始化
临易i
·
2022-08-27 21:36
java
jvm
开发语言
【JAVA进阶篇】字符串的详细介绍
Java学习String字符串概述String类的特点String字符串
常量池
String字符串的构造方法String字符串的23个常用方法StringBuilder类/StringBuffer类StringBuilde
YOU__FEI
·
2022-08-26 17:39
JAVA学习
java
开发语言
intellij-idea
面试
【day8】String类、static、Arrays类、Math类
02_字符串的构造方法和直接创建03_字符串的
常量池
字符串
常量池
:程序当中直接写上的双引号字符串,就在字符串
常量池
中。
饮马翰海
·
2022-08-24 18:53
JAVA学习(网盘版)
jvm
java
数据结构
进程和线程的区别和联系
有两种方式:进程池:像String
常量池
、数据库中的连接池,使用进程池来存储多个进程,
囚蕤
·
2022-08-19 18:46
进程和线程的区别
synchronized对象锁?如何用synchronized锁字符串对象,这里面的坑要注意
文章目录写在前面synchronized锁对象synchronized锁固定对象synchronized锁新建对象synchronized锁对象的业务idid已经存在字符串
常量池
中id不存在字符串
常量池
中手动将
秃了也弱了。
·
2022-08-17 14:25
java
java
jvm
面试
如何实现 System.out.println("a") 显示 b
今天看到一篇文章不用反射,能否交换两个字符串的值.心想字符串常量在
常量池
里面,是在就算用了反射也交换不了吧。
计数寄存器
·
2022-08-12 16:00
【从零开始的Java开发】1-5-2 包装类与基本数据类型、常用API、基本数据类型与包装类、字符串之间的转换、包装类的初始值与比较、对象
常量池
文章目录包装类与基本数据类型包装类常用方法基本数据类型与包装类之间的转换基本数据类型和字符串之间的转换包装类相关知识包装类的初始值包装类对象间的比较对象
常量池
总结包装类与基本数据类型Java的数据类型:
karshey
·
2022-08-04 15:45
从零开始的Java开发
java
jvm
开发语言
java字符串
替换一部分_将字符串的一部分替换为另一个字符串
蝴蝶不菲有一个函数可以在字符串中找到子字符串(find),以及将字符串中的特定范围替换为另一个字符串的函数(replace),所以您可以将它们结合起来以获得所需的效果:boolreplace(std::string&str,conststd::string&from,conststd::string&to){size_tstart_pos=str.find(from);if(start_pos==
比的原理
·
2022-08-01 09:50
java字符串替换一部分
java字符串
替换某一段替换_将字符串的一部分替换为另一个字符串
有一个函数可以在字符串中找到子字符串(find),以及将字符串中的特定范围替换为另一个字符串的函数(replace),所以您可以将它们结合起来以获得所需的效果:boolreplace(std::string&str,conststd::string&from,conststd::string&to){size_tstart_pos=str.find(from);if(start_pos==std:
小爱酱的万水千山
·
2022-08-01 09:20
java字符串替换某一段替换
java字符串
替换某个字符_【JAVA】找出文本中指定规律的字符,并替换其中某些字符...
##这代码有什么用?我能帮您从一个文本文件中找出所有指定规律的字符,并且还能替换结果中的某个指定字符,最后再打印出来。这里的“规律”是指匹配正则表达式。##怎么实现的?文本文件的读取是通过BufferedReader和FileReader来实现:BufferedReaderbr=newBufferedReader(newFileReader("E:/kk.txt"));Strings=null;w
柒源
·
2022-08-01 09:47
java字符串替换某个字符
java 字符串替换
文章目录字符串替换方法
Java字符串
替换指定位置的字符字符串替换方法在Java中,String类提供了3种字符串替换方法,分别是replace()、replaceFirst()和replaceAll()
liuec1002
·
2022-08-01 09:22
java
java
开发语言
Java 类加载过程与类加载器详细介绍
链接验证:检验.class文件的安全性准备:为静态类型变量分配内存并设置默认值解析:将
常量池
内的符号引用转换为直接引用,符号引用指向一个未被加载的类,或者未被加载类的字段或方法,那么解析将触发这个类的加
·
2022-07-31 10:29
java Class文件结构解析
常量池
字节码
目录Class文件结构整体结构文件头
常量池
属性表Code_attribute结构函数表/字段表字节码解析Class文件结构整体结构ClassFile{u4magic;u2minor_version;u2major_version
·
2022-07-29 11:36
【JVM 系列】JVM 调优
四、
常量池
4.1、Class
常量池
(静态
常量池
)4.2、运行时常量4.3、字符串
常量池
五、String类的分析5.1、String对象的不可变性5.2、String的创建方式及内存分配的方式5.3、intern
半身风雪
·
2022-07-27 16:33
架构之Java
筑基
jvm
java
算法
【深入理解java虚拟机】 - class类文件结构
文章目录概述平台无关性Class类文件的结构class文件格式class文件结构魔数文件版本号
常量池
访问标识类索引、父类索引与接口索引集合字段表集合方法表集合属性表集合概述“一次编写,到处运行(WriteOnce
1 + 1=王
·
2022-07-19 20:03
JVM
java
jvm
虚拟机
class
类文件结构
Java面试系列-进阶知识-JVM相关
你怎么理解
常量池
?JVM的运行时数据区有哪些?什么是堆内存?堆内存包括哪些部分?什么是非堆内存?什么是内存溢出?什么是内存泄漏?内存溢出和内存泄漏两者有
~本特利~
·
2022-07-19 19:45
java
面试
开发语言
String、StringBuilder、StringBuffer以及它们之间的区别
存在字符串
常量池
中2.Stringname=newString("中国加油");//String对象创建开
爱喝冰红茶阿
·
2022-07-17 07:25
java
string
2019-6-17牛客网刷题易错知识点
用new创建的对象在堆区函数中的临时变量在栈去java中的字符串在字符串常量区栈:存放基本类型的数据和对象的引用,但对象本身不存放在栈中,而是存放在堆中静态域:存放在对象中用static定义的静态成员
常量池
请叫我小白呗
·
2022-07-09 12:05
笔记
零基础学Java(4)字符串
字符串从概念上讲,
Java字符串
就是Unicode字符序列。例如,字符串"Java\u2122"由5个Unicode字符J、a、v、a和™组成。
Silent丿丶黑羽
·
2022-07-06 10:00
java字符串
的替换replace、replaceAll、replaceFirst的区别说明
目录字符串的替换replace、replaceAll、replaceFirst区别不多解释,看代码replaceAll、replaceFirst使用需要注意的问题类型定义如下如果我们这样写我实现了这两个方法,大家可以直接引用字符串的替换replace、replaceAll、replaceFirst区别如果不是刚刚复习了下正则表达式,我可能也不会注意到,原来String的replaceAll跟rep
·
2022-07-05 13:08
JVM学习
什么是JVMJVM学习路线内存结构程序计数器栈栈的简单介绍Java虚拟机栈栈内存溢出线程运行诊断案例1:CPU占用过多案例2:程序运行很长时间没有结果本地方法栈堆堆_内存溢出堆内存诊断方法区方法区溢出
常量池
什么是
君陌上
·
2022-06-28 19:25
java
经验分享
面试
JVM的GC ROOTS有哪些?
1、虚拟机栈(局部变量表中引用的对象)2、本地方法栈(本地方法引用的对象)3、方法区中静态属性引用的对象4、方法区中静态
常量池
中引用的对象以上几个地方是垃圾回收开始扫描对象引用链的GCROOTS。
荆茗Scaler
·
2022-06-27 22:13
JVM
jvm垃圾回收
jvm
GC
ROOTS
JVM I——JVM理解及内存区域划分
操作系统、硬件的关系3、JVM、操作系统、硬件执行流程三、JVM运行时内存1、线程私有区域1)程序计数器2)Java虚拟机栈3)本地方法栈2、线程共享内存区域1)Java堆java堆溢出2)方法区3)运行时
常量池
一
爱得恋
·
2022-06-24 12:19
JAVA
Web
final关键字的使用详解
修饰的变量不可以被改变.但是后面的却不是很理解:如果修饰引用,那么表示引用不可变,引用指向的内容可变.被final修饰的方法,JVM会尝试将其内联,以提高运行效率,被final修饰的常量,在编译阶段会存入
常量池
中
·
2022-06-23 11:43
java
Class文件的字段与方法
引导Class文件的基本结构Class文件的
常量池
Class文件的访问标志,类索引,父类索引,接口索引Class文件的字段和方法Class文件中的字段在Class文件的基本结构一文中,简单的介绍了class
你怕是很皮哦
·
2022-06-22 19:22
带你一文深入认识Java String类
目录前言一、认识String1.JDK中的String2.创建字符串的四种方式3.字符串的字面量4.字符串比较相等二、字符串的
常量池
1.什么是字符串
常量池
2.手工入池方法三、字符串的不可变性1.为什么不可变
·
2022-06-22 15:12
使用Java实现大小写转换实例代码
今天刚学的
java字符串
大小写的转化写的不详细或错误请指出啊谢谢!!!
·
2022-06-15 18:57
java基础---String长度限制透彻解析
文章目录前言一、String源码分析二、编译期
常量池
限制什么是码点?
chihaihai
·
2022-06-09 22:35
java基础
java
字符串
jdk
jvm
Java8常量为什么放在堆内存,大厂面试必考-JVM 内存管理 Java8
2.JVM内存布局3.虚拟机栈4.程序计数器5.堆6.元空间7.其他面试题7.1
常量池
去哪里了?7.2堆、非堆、本地内存,有什么关系?8.总结8.1JVM如何进行内存区域的划分?
weixin_39586825
·
2022-06-08 14:34
Java8常量为什么放在堆内存
Java中String类的split方法
今天想用
Java字符串
类的split方法切割一个图片文件名,获取不带后缀的文件名,开始这么用的:publicclassTest{publicstaticvoidmain(String[]args){StringfullName
yubo_725
·
2022-06-05 08:27
Java
Java
正则表达式
split方法
String类
字符串切割
java中String.intern()方法功能介绍
String.intern():此方法是一个Native方法底层调用C++的StringTable::intern方法实现当通过语句str.intern()调用intern()方法后JVM就会在当前类的
常量池
中查找是否存在与
·
2022-06-02 12:17
面试题-JVM性能调优
目录前言JVM性能调优内存溢出错误堆溢出错误和预判堆溢出的错误虚拟机栈和本地方法栈溢出错误方法区(元数据区)和运行时
常量池
溢出直接内存区域的溢出实践案例如何正确利用大内存-高性能硬件上的程序部署策略如何排查内存溢出错误如何排查系统
·
2022-05-31 15:06
java
上一页
25
26
27
28
29
30
31
32
下一页
按字母分类:
A
B
C
D
E
F
G
H
I
J
K
L
M
N
O
P
Q
R
S
T
U
V
W
X
Y
Z
其他